Output 100d569a255a04ca2a8e74bc6b7cbd89fea177e99857b814b3ed7bddab6b9169:26

value
505220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7cad538917f89c562e28d3e0717142699c72469 OP_EQUAL
address
3QHDp16TewyKWKCtfS4ncnqmiVrQGYZjzh
transaction
100d569a255a04ca2a8e74bc6b7cbd89fea177e99857b814b3ed7bddab6b9169
spent
true